West Coast Main Line suffers more problems

Signal fault ends week-long woes for travellers

Rail passengers have endured more misery with delays to services on the West Coast Main Line through Milton Keynes and Leighton Buzzard.

Signalling problems near Leighton Buzzard saw services delayed by up to 40 minutes and some cancelled during the morning rush today, Friday.

The fault was repaired and normal services resumed at just before 10am said a Network Rail spokesman.
